For instance, if you do 2 strokes, then treat, 3 strokes, then treat, 4 strokes then treat, your dog may come to understand that time he is being brushed is getting increasingly longer, and he may therefore come to dread it. The most commonly observed obsessive-compulsive behaviors are spinning, tail chasing, self-mutilation, hallucinating (fly biting), circling, fence running, hair/air biting, pica (appetite for non-food substances such as dirt, rocks or feces), pacing, staring, and vocalizing.
